Transaction 4e8620dd45c502779341ec34d93d0689dc174f25628a7b03ccfd6f68e670bb4d

1 Input
2 Outputs
  • 4e8620dd45c502779341ec34d93d0689dc174f25628a7b03ccfd6f68e670bb4d:0
  • value  146397636
    address  3KouqG4NqgUJqdXLyvWJzA8ZxK9rwdLWVY
  • 4e8620dd45c502779341ec34d93d0689dc174f25628a7b03ccfd6f68e670bb4d:1
  • value  144101570
    address  1Hmcksvg28SHVDJ1eNnVTHg2gRFhA7KvoG